Salisbury stores found selling e-cigarettes that exceed legal limits and fail to verify buyer's age, leading to fines and confiscation.

Recently, according to a report by Salisburyjournal, four newly opened e-cigarette shops in Salisbury, United Kingdom, have been found to sell e-cigarettes with nicotine levels exceeding the local tobacco product regulations. Among them, Grocery and Vape store on Catherine Street stands out for selling e-cigarettes with a maximum capacity of 20 milliliters, attracting attention. It is notable that this store has not been verifying the age of purchasers to ensure they are over 18 years old.

 

Earlier, a reporter secretly purchased e-cigarettes from these stores and reported on them, resulting in three stores being caught in a surprise inspection on November 10th. Over 1000 illegal e-cigarettes were seized during the operation.
